ButtFREE Toolkit
In developing the Toolkit, Butt Free Australia combined current community-based social marketing theory, behavioural research and litter management expertise relevant to butt littering in Australia with its most valuable resource – practical experience of ButtFREE projects since 2003. The Toolkit focuses on planning projects to address influences on butt littering: how, where and when people litter – or 'butt littering behaviour' – and why they litter, based on knowledge, attitudes and perceptions. These influences and the tools required to address them are known as ButtFREE Solutions: Context, Awareness, Education, Infrastructure and Enforcement. Toolkit structureThe Toolkit consists of step-by-step sections, each with background, actions and tools.
It provides tools to measure, evaluate and report project results. The Toolkit also provides an implementation checklist as a guide to support your project management experience. The Toolkit components can be downloaded by clicking on the section titles below. |
